.flex.min-h-screen{margin-left:calc(-1*var(--wp--style--global--content-size, 0px)/2);margin-right:calc(-1*var(--wp--style--global--content-size, 0px)/2);width:100vw;max-width:100vw}.flex.min-h-screen input,.flex.min-h-screen button{box-sizing:border-box;font-family:inherit}.flex.min-h-screen input:focus{outline:none}.mabbly-form{max-width:420px;margin:0 auto;padding:2rem;background:#fff;border-radius:8px;box-shadow:0 2px 12px rgba(0,0,0,.08)}.mabbly-form .mabbly-logo{display:block;max-width:160px;margin:0 auto 1.5rem}.mabbly-form .mabbly-field{margin-bottom:1rem}.mabbly-form .mabbly-field label{display:block;font-weight:600;margin-bottom:.25rem}.mabbly-form .mabbly-field input{width:100%;padding:.5rem .75rem;border:1px solid #ccc;border-radius:4px;font-size:1rem;box-sizing:border-box}.mabbly-form .mabbly-field input[aria-invalid=true]{border-color:#e02020}.mabbly-form .mabbly-field .mabbly-error{display:block;color:#e02020;font-size:.8rem;margin-top:.2rem;min-height:1em}.mabbly-form .mabbly-form-message{margin-bottom:.75rem;font-size:.9rem}.mabbly-form .mabbly-form-message.mabbly-message--error{color:#e02020}.mabbly-form .mabbly-form-message.mabbly-message--success{color:#1a8a1a}.mabbly-form .mabbly-btn{width:100%;padding:.65rem 1rem;background:#2563eb;color:#fff;border:none;border-radius:4px;font-size:1rem;cursor:pointer}.mabbly-form .mabbly-btn:hover{background:#1d4ed8}.mabbly-form .mabbly-btn:disabled{opacity:.6;cursor:not-allowed}
